Interactive Learning Tools: Enhancing Engagement

Using interactive learning tools is one of the most effective ways to engage children. These tools make learning enjoyable and cater to various learning styles. Here are some examples:

  1. Educational Apps: Many apps offer interactive quizzes, puzzles, and games that enhance learning in a fun way. These tools often align with STEM education for primary students, promoting critical thinking and problem-solving skills.
  2. Hands-On Activities: Simple experiments, art projects, and building exercises can significantly enhance a child’s understanding of scientific concepts and creativity. For instance, using building blocks to teach basic math or physics concepts can make learning tangible.
  3. Storytelling and Role Play: Encouraging children to engage in storytelling or role-playing activities enhances their creativity and communication skills. This method supports inclusive education practices, as it allows children of different backgrounds and abilities to participate equally.
